KJP Announces $50 BILLION 'Loan' To Ukraine | Here Are The Flaws With It
Drew Berquist and Tom Cunningham discuss the $50 billion loan to Ukraine, emphasizing skepticism about Ukraine's ability to repay and questioning the true intentions behind the aid. They argue that Ukraine, known for corruption, is unlikely to repay the loan, and suggest that the U.S. and G7 are using the aid to further their own interests, including political gain and potential money laundering. The conversation also touches on the semantics of labeling the aid as a "loan" rather than a "giveaway," and compares it to the controversial use of language in political contexts, such as Kamala Harris being referred to as a "border czar."
